Pellegrini: “The victory is deserved for this great team”

The Málaga CF coach, Manuel Pellegrini, spoke to the media at La Rosaleda, following the Málaga – Espanyol match.

Statements from Pellegrini
 
(Match review) “It was very important for us to win, because if not Espanyol would have been five points ahead, and this is a good advantage.  On the one hand, I’m happy as a very good team won, we overcame them at various stages of the match; but on the other we could have had a bigger win.  It’s complicated to decide impartially if the referee was fair to us or not.  The victory is deserved for a great team.  I think the difference between us and Espanyol wasn’t down to the referee.  If we look at the amount of chances to score we had and also Espanyol, there’s an important difference that the score doesn’t reflect”.
 
(Short term objectives)  “No, the objective isn’t Europe, but to show week after week that we’re capable.  There’s nothing worse in football to have fixed objectives, one thing is to build the team, but another the reality of playing week in week out, which is what will take us to Europe.  We’ll have to improve in the intensity of game-play in the first few minutes.  The team’s anxiety is normal until they regain their confidence”.
 
(Penalty, fans and the match) “There are many of the team able to take penalties, we’re lucky as we have very good ‘kickers’ for penalties.  We had a difficult time at home last year, the public support is very important.  The team will go out and play and hopefully beat Betis at their ground.  As for the game not changing, I couldn’t be happier than I am today”.
